This jewelry piece is an elegant anniversary-style band crafted in two-tone gold, weighing approximately 4.77 grams. The ring features a wide, textured face tapering into a smooth shank. The central design is characterized by multiple rows of small, round-cut stones—likely diamonds or cubic zirconia—pavé-set in a white gold or rhodium-plated mounting to enhance brilliance. These shimmering sections are bifurcated by a polished, curved ribbon of yellow gold, creating a sophisticated bypass or 'wave' aesthetic. The piece displays a blend of late 20th-century design influences, commonly seen in fine jewelry from the 1980s or 1990s. The construction appears sturdy with a solid under-gallery, though the camera perspective obscures specific hallmarks. Condition-wise, the ring shows signs of light wear, including minor surface abrasions and a slight dulling of the polish on the yellow gold band, consistent with regular use. The stones appear secure in their settings, and the overall craftsmanship suggests a mass-produced but high-quality commercial fine jewelry piece. Upon my visual examination of this two-tone anniversary band, I have assessed its value based on a weight of 4.77 grams and its aesthetic features. The piece exhibits a classic late-20th-century bypass design, characteristic of high-quality commercial fine jewelry. The craftsmanship is solid, featuring a robust under-gallery and secure pavé settings. The condition is graded as 'Good,' showing expected minor surface abrasions and light oxidation on the 10k or 14k yellow gold sections consistent with regular wear. The market for this style remains steady, particularly for buyers seeking traditional bridal or anniversary jewelry with substantial gold weight. The primary value drivers are the intrinsic melt value of the gold and the decorative appeal of the diamond-accented cluster. However, several limitations exist in this remote assessment. To finalize a formal authentication, I would require a physical inspection to verify hallmarks and conduct an acid or XRF test to confirm gold purity. Furthermore, the stones must be tested with a diamond multi-tester and measured to determine total carat weight and clarity grade, as they could be high-quality stimulants like Cubic Zirconia or Moissanite. Secondary market comparables for similar 4-5 gram two-tone bands suggest a retail replacement value within the stated range, though a liquid auction value would be closer to the spot gold price plus a 20% premium for the design.
